The Historical Context of Russian Sports Science
Russia's track record in the realm of performance enhancement is not accidental. Throughout the Soviet age, the state invested greatly in sports medicine and pharmacology to ensure dominance on the international stage. This legacy resulted in the advancement of sophisticated substances and a pharmaceutical facilities that remains prominent today. Unlike many Western nations where PEDs are strictly restricted and often only discovered in underground laboratories (UGLs), Russia keeps a market where several performance-related compounds are produced by legitimate pharmaceutical companies.

3. Metabolic Modulators
Maybe the most famous Russian-developed drug recently is Meldonium (Mildronate). Established in Latvia throughout the Soviet period, it stays commonly readily available in Russia. It is developed to improve basal metabolism and is utilized by professional athletes to enhance endurance and healing.
4. Nootropics and Stimulants
Beyond physical muscle development, the Russian market is known for "Cognitive Enhancers" or nootropics. Compounds like Phenotropil (Phenylpiracetam) were originally established for cosmonauts to enhance psychological clarity and physical endurance under tension.

3. What is Meldonium?
Meldonium (Mildronate) is a metabolic modulator developed in the Eastern Bloc. It is utilized to treat ischemia and enhance blood circulation. It became popular in the sporting world after it was banned by WADA in 2016, following numerous prominent positive tests by Russian professional athletes.
